Silicon Nitride

The Silicon Nitride is among the hardest and most resistant technical ceramics. It has also a high resistance to thermal shocks, to wear and corrosion (liquid and gas). Its application is found in the components of pumps and valves, semiconductors among others.… Read more >

Aluminium Nitride

The high mechanical properties of this ceramic, combined with high thermal conductivity and electrical insulation, are highly recommended in electronics industry.

Properties :

• High thermal conductivity • Electrical insulation • Good mechanical strength

Applications :

• Electronics Industry… Read more >

HAP (Hydroxyapatite/TCP)

Hydroxyapatite/TCP: material used in the biomedical applications for the manufacture of the osseous substitutes, chemical composition close to bone.

Properties :

• Biocompatibility • Excellent bioactivity • Good osseointegration

Applications :

• Tibial osteotomy wedges • Intervertebral cages • Cranial implants • Bone substitute • Spine implants • Orthopedic implants… Read more >

TCP (Tricalcium Phosphate)

TCP or Tricalcium Phosphate is a material often used for implants in the medical field, especially to recreate parts close to the structure of a spine.

Properties :

• Biocompatible • Bioresorbable

Applications :

• Implants… Read more >
